A video showing figures appearing to stand on clouds has gone viral, sparking speculation about aliens. It was posted by Myra ...
A video showing figures appearing to stand on clouds has gone viral, sparking speculation about aliens. It was posted by Myra ...
Protecting life, caring for wounded life, restoring dignity to the life of every ‘born of woman’ is the fundamental basis for ...